Mooz, Elizabeth Dodd was born on November 22, 1939 in Middletown, Connecticut, United States. Daughter of J. Alfred C. and Lillian Hall (Potter) Dodd.
Bachelor, Hollins College, 1961. Doctor of Philosophy, Tufts University, 1967.
Instructor, University of Pennsylvania Graduate Hospital, Philadelphia, 1967-1969; postdoctoral fellow, U. Delaware, 1969-1971; assistant professor, U. Delaware, Newark, 1971-1973; research associate, Bowdoin College, Brunswick, Maine., 1973-1976; assistant professor, Medical College Virginia, Richmond, 1977-1979; research scientist, Philip Morris United States of America, Richmond, 1979-1989; grants analyst, Moody Foundation, Galveston, Texas, 1989-1991; grants consultant, Dallas, 1991-1993; science review coordinator, American Heart Association National Center, Dallas, 1993-1995; special projects consultant, Virginia Beach, Virginia, since 1995. Member state advising committee New England Board Higher Education, Brunswick, 1975-1977;member seminars committee Science Museum Virginia, Richmond, 1985-1989.
State delegate Republican Center Committee Texas, Galveston, 1990-1991. Member American Chemical Society (Women's chemist committee 1980-1987, James Lewis Howe award 1961), Rotary, Sigma Xi (president Medical College Virginia chapter 1983).
Married R. Peter Mooz, August 29, 1964. Children: Ralph Peter Junior, Christopher Dodd.
